From 5efd394ce8aaa97e62e22e54824eb1703f75b7c7 Mon Sep 17 00:00:00 2001 From: echarp Date: Sun, 12 Nov 2017 19:12:48 +0100 Subject: [PATCH] Quick correction, so that nil repeatitions will not generate an exception --- app/models/event_callbacks.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/models/event_callbacks.rb b/app/models/event_callbacks.rb index 832c377b..0a49a067 100644 --- a/app/models/event_callbacks.rb +++ b/app/models/event_callbacks.rb @@ -16,7 +16,7 @@ class EventCallbacks def self.before_update(event) return unless event.moderated_changed? && event.moderated? event.decision_time = Time.zone.now - create_repeats event if event.repeat > 0 && event.rule + create_repeats event if event.repeat.try(:positive?) && event.rule end def self.after_update(event)